The Germany 2014 World Cup home shirt is in the team’s traditional white with the red and black German national flag featured throughout. It is the first German national team jersey to include the recently updated DFB badge. Three chevron-shaped bands appear on the chest area of the kit in differing shades of red. The design is meant to be a new interpretation of Germany’s flag.
In a departure from Germany’s traditional black home shorts, 2014/15 home kit is completed by predominantly white shorts and socks. Like the new German national team jersey, the shorts and socks feature red and black elements.
“The white shorts symbolise the ease of play of the German game. It is a statement of class, elegance and love of the game,” said Jürgen Rank, Chief Designer for football apparel at adidas.
Philipp Lahm, German team captain: “It’s great that the new outfit is one colour from socks to jersey.”
Currently ranked second in the world by FIFA, Germany will wear their 2014 World Cup home kit for the first time in an international friendly against Italy on November 15th in Milan.
